In October of My dog bit my neighbor. The neighbors family only wanted us to pay for her medical bills. I called my agent as I thought they were honest, and out to help me. I asked her if I needed to report this claim to them and she advised me that I did. I specifically asked her is this going to jack my rates, she said that I would ONLY lose my 15% claim free discount. So I went ahead and filed the claim. I had not heard anything about the claim since I talked to the adjuster in october, I thought it was over with, no big deal.
Now five months later I receive a renewal notice, not only did I get a 15% increase in my policy but Allstate was kind enough to hit me with a $260.00 "surcharge" along with a general rate increase, my rate went up a total of $390.00 per year.
I went in to see the agent and find out what had happened, and now she tells me about this "surcharge". I feel this is deceptive practice, and feel that I have been totally violated due to trusting my agent.
I called corporate office and filed a complaint. Then the girl from my office called me and could not understand why I filed a complaint against her. I told her noting personal, but that is what she had told me, and I was stupid enough to beleive her. Then she said she was really surprised Allstate did not just drop me.
I have tried to get new quotes from different insurance companies, and having this dog bite claim on my record is definatly worse than having a felony charge on your record. My next step is to report this to the Illinois Department of Insurance.
